god

Amalthea

also: Amalthea, Amaltheia

The nymph (in some accounts a she-goat) who nursed the infant Zeus on Crete; her name evokes abundance and the cornucopia, and Atticus named his Epirote shrine the Amaltheum (place:amaltheum) after her (Att. 1.16.15, 1.16.18).
